How to prepare Apple Caramel Bombs
Ingredients:
- 2 medium apples (Granny Smith or Honeycrisp) 🍏🍎, peeled and diced
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ter 🧈
- 3 tablespoons brown sugar 🟫
Instructions:
- In a skillet over medium heat, melt the unsalted butter. 🍳
- Add the diced apples to the skillet and sauté for about 3-4 minutes until they start to soften. 🍏
- Sprinkle the brown sugar over the apples, stirring gently until the apples are coated and the sugar begins to caramelize (about 2-3 minutes). 🍬
- Remove the skillet from heat and let the mixture cool slightly.
- Once cooled, scoop the apple mixture into small serving bowls or cups, creating your Apple Caramel Bombs! 🌟

How to store Apple Caramel Bombs
If you have any leftovers (which is unlikely!), store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They can last for about 2-3 days. When you’re ready to enjoy them again, simply reheat them in the microwave for a few seconds.
Tips for preparing Apple Caramel Bombs
- For a deeper caramel flavor, try using dark brown sugar instead of light brown sugar.
- Keep an eye on your apples while cooking to avoid burning. Adjust the cooking time depending on how soft you like your apples.
- Experiment with spices like cinnamon or nutmeg for an aromatic twist to your Apple Caramel Bombs!

FAQs
Can I use different types of apples?
Yes! While Granny Smith and Honeycrisp are great choices, you can use any apple variety you like. Just remember that some apples are sweeter than others, so adjust the sugar accordingly.
